What Is Cheek Filler Treatment And How It Works?

Cheek Fillers Injections in Dubai(حقن حشو الخد في دبي) involves injecting dermal fillers, typically composed of hyaluronic acid, into the midface to restore volume and improve contour. Fillers work by:

  • Restoring volume: Filling hollow areas in the cheeks caused by aging or weight loss.

  • Providing lift and definition: Enhancing cheekbones and creating a youthful profile.

  • Stimulating collagen: Encouraging natural collagen production over time for firmer skin.

  • Improving hydration: Hyaluronic acid attracts and retains water, keeping the skin plump.
    These effects work across most skin types, but variations in thickness, elasticity, and sensitivity can influence treatment outcomes.

Types Of Cheek Fillers And Their Suitability:

Different types of cheek fillers are suited for various skin types and aesthetic goals:

  • Hyaluronic acid fillers: Versatile and compatible with most skin types; can be dissolved if needed.

  • Calcium hydroxylapatite fillers: Provide firmer support for mature skin or deeper hollows.

  • Poly-L-lactic acid fillers: Encourage gradual collagen growth, ideal for long-term rejuvenation.

  • Combination treatments: Pairing fillers with skin boosters or hydrating serums enhances outcomes for sensitive or dry skin.
    Selecting the right filler ensures a natural look and reduces potential side effects for each skin type.

What Is Fine Line Treatment And How It Works?

Fine Lines and Wrinkles Removal in Dubai(الخطوط الدقيقة والتجاعيد في دبي) focus on stimulating collagen production, improving skin texture, and promoting cellular renewal. These procedures target the underlying causes of aging, rather than just masking the symptoms. Treatments such as laser resurfacing, microneedling, chemical peels, and radiofrequency therapy are designed to enhance skin regeneration and smooth out lines over time. Each method works differently but aims to improve the skin’s overall health and appearance.

  • Laser resurfacing uses focused beams of light to remove damaged skin layers and trigger collagen growth.

  • Microneedling creates micro-injuries that encourage new skin cell formation and firmness.

  • Chemical peels exfoliate dead skin, revealing fresh and youthful layers underneath.

  • Radiofrequency tightens the skin by heating deeper tissues, promoting natural collagen synthesis.

With consistent care, these treatments help reduce fine lines and prevent new ones from forming, offering long-lasting rejuvenation.

What Is The Treatment And How It Works?

To understand Laser Hair Bleaching in Dubai(تشقير الشعر بالليزر في دبي) vs. Traditional Hair Lightening, it’s essential to grasp how each method functions. Laser hair bleaching uses concentrated light energy that targets the melanin in the hair shaft. The laser’s controlled pulses break down the pigment, resulting in lighter, less noticeable hair. It’s a non-invasive and gentle procedure that enhances skin brightness while preserving its natural texture.

In contrast, traditional hair lightening involves applying chemical agents, such as hydrogen peroxide or ammonia-based formulas, directly to the hair. These products oxidize the melanin, stripping it of color and turning it into a lighter shade. While this method is accessible and inexpensive, it often causes dryness, irritation, or uneven color results, especially on sensitive skin.

Laser technology offers precision and uniformity that chemical bleaching cannot achieve. It targets specific areas without damaging the surrounding skin, ensuring even coverage and a long-lasting, radiant finish.

What Is The Treatment And How It Works?

The Saxenda injection in Dubai(حقن ساكسيندا في دبي) is a prescription medication containing liraglutide, a compound that replicates the natural hormone GLP-1 (glucagon-like peptide-1). This hormone regulates appetite and food intake by interacting with specific areas of the brain that control hunger and satiety. Saxenda works by slowing gastric emptying, increasing feelings of fullness, and reducing overall calorie consumption.
What sets it apart from other treatments is its ability to support steady, controlled weight loss without aggressive appetite suppression or dehydration effects. Unlike stimulant-based injections that only produce short-term results, Saxenda encourages healthy, long-term changes by aligning with your body’s natural biological processes.

Ideal Candidate And How To Choose A Right Clinic:

The Saxenda injections for weight loss(حقن ساكسيندا لإنقاص الوزن) is suitable for adults with a body mass index (BMI) of 30 or higher, or those with a BMI of 27 or higher who experience obesity-related medical conditions such as high blood pressure or type 2 diabetes. Ideal candidates are individuals who have struggled with weight loss through diet and exercise alone and are ready to make lasting lifestyle changes.
